td{vertical-align:top;}
.noWrap{white-space:nowrap;}

a img{border:0;}
a,a:link,a:active,a:visited {text-decoration:none;color:#CE0008;}
.mainContentCell a:link,
.mainContentCell a:active,
.mainContentCell a:visited { text-decoration:underline; }
a:hover{color:#CE0008;text-decoration:underline;}

hr{height:1px;border:0 none;clear:both;display:block;}

.bodytext { letter-spacing:0.3px; line-height:18px; margin:0 0 24px 0; }
.startseite-news .bodytext { letter-spacing:inherit; line-height:inherit; margin:0 0 8px 0; }

.startseite-news a.internal-link { background:url(/img/arrow_red.gif);
	background-repeat:no-repeat; background-position:right 3px; padding-right:13px; }

h1 {font-size:12px;margin:18px 0 12px 0;color:#424142;}
h1 .mpRedTitle,.mpRedTitle{color:#CE0008;}
h1 .mpGreenTitle,.mpGreenTitle{color:#ADC39C;}
h1 .mpBlueTitle,.mpBlueTitle{color:#004D84;}
h1 .mpGreyTitle,.mpGreyTitle{color:#ADBABD;}
h1 .mpRedVioletTitle,.mpRedVioletTitle{color:#844D9C;}
h1 .mpYellowTitle,.mpYellowTitle{color:#E7E0BA;}
h1 .mpOrangeTitle,.mpOrangeTitle{color:#EF8218;}
h1 .mpBrownTitle,.mpBrownTitle{color:#7C695A;}
h5 {font-size:12px;margin:18px 0 12px 0;color:#EF8218;}

b .mpGrey, .mpGrey{color:#424142;}
b .mpRed, .mpRed{color:#CE0008 !important;}

.w160{width:160px;}
.w318{width:138px;}
.w5{width:5px;}
.w1{width:1px;}
.w459{width:459px;}
.w37{width:37px;}
.w99{width:99px;}
.w6{width:6px;}

.mainTable{width:1263px;margin:-3px 0 0 0; } /*w:1263*/
.topFullWidTD{width:1263px;height:2px;}
.bottomGrey{height:2px;}
.bottomLeft{width:2px;height:17px;background:url(../img/shadow-bottom-regular.gif);background-repeat:repeat-x;}

.leftOutsideCol{width:160px;height:862px;}
.topOutsideMenuCell{width:318px;height:38px;background-color:#EBEBEB;}
.topOutsideMenuCell2{width:6px;height:38px;background-color:#EBEBEB;}
.topOutsideRightMenuCell{width:105px;height:38px;background:url(../img/bg-topright.gif);}

.rightOutsideCol{width:178px;height:862px;} /*178*/
.leftShadowCellCol{width:5px;background:url(../img/shadow-left.gif);background-repeat:repeat-y;}
.rightShadowCellCol{width:6px;background:url(../img/shadow-right.gif) top right;background-repeat:repeat-y;} 

.mpVersicherungLogoText{width:272px;height:118px;padding:104px 0 0 188px;background-color:#fff;}
.mpVersicherungLogoText img { position:absolute; left:516px; top:170px; }
.mpLogoCell{width:136px;background-color:#fff;}
.backdroppedLeftCell{width:323px;/*height:391px;background-color:#efebef;*/font-size:11px;}
.mainContentOuterCell{width:596px;height:689px;background-color:#fff;/*border:solid 1px #eeeeee;*/}
.mainContentWrapperTable{background-color:#fff;}
.mainContentHeaderCell{background-color:#fff;width:596px;font-size:12px;}
.mainContentCell{width:508px;height:100%;background-color:#fff;padding:0px 54px 0px 34px;font-size:11px;}

.topMenu{width:487px;height:39px;background-color:#EBEBEB;padding:13px 0 0 0;}
.topMenu a,.topMenu a:link, .topMenu a:visited{color:#424142;padding:0 7px 0 7px; white-space:nowrap; }
.topMenu a:hover,.topMenu a:active{text-decoration:underline;}
.topMenu a .act,.topMenu a:link .act, .topMenu a:visited .act{color:#CE0008 !important;}

.leftMenu{width:188px;height:262px;background-color:#EBEBEB;padding:15px 0px 0 130px;font-size:12px;}
.leftMenu a,.leftMenu a:link, .leftMenu a:visited{color:#424142;font-size:12px;letter-spacing:0.8px;_letter-spacing:1.5px;}
.leftMenu a:hover,.leftMenu a:active{text-decoration:underline;}

.leftMenu a .act,.leftMenu a:link .act, .leftMenu a:visited .act,.act{color:#CE0008 !important;}
.leftMenu a .actBlue,.leftMenu a:link .actBlue, .leftMenu a:visited .actBlue,.actBlue{color:#004D85 !important;}
.leftMenu a .actGrey,.leftMenu a:link .actGrey, .leftMenu a:visited .actGrey,.actGrey{color:#8E9C9C !important;}
.leftMenu a .actBrown,.leftMenu a:link .actBrown, .leftMenu a:visited .actBrown,.actBrown{color:#7C695A !important;}
.leftMenu a .actGreen,.leftMenu a:link .actGreen, .leftMenu a:visited .actGreen,.actGreen{color:#758467 !important;}
.leftMenu a .actYellow,.leftMenu a:link .actYellow, .leftMenu a:visited .actYellow,.actYellow{color:#E7E3BD !important;}
.leftMenu a .actYellow,.leftMenu a:link .actYellow, .leftMenu a:visited .actYellow,.actYellow{color:#E7E3BD !important;}
.leftMenu a .actPink,.leftMenu a:link .actPink, .leftMenu a:visited .actPink,.actPink{color:#844D9C !important;}

.leftMenu hr{background-color:#CE0008;color:#CE0008;height:1px;border:0 none;clear:both;display:block;width:158px;margin:10px 20px 10px 0;_margin:4px 20px 2px 0;}

.topmenu,.leftMenu{ color:#424542;font-size:11px;font-weight:bold;}

.searchCell{width:201px;height:34px;background-color:#EBEBEB;padding:0 0 0 117px;}

.ksLeftIllu { width:323px; height:100%; }
.ksIllu0{background:url(../../../../../fileadmin/illus_left/illu_01.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u1{background:url(../../../../../fileadmin/illus_left/illu_02.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u2{background:url(../../../../../fileadmin/illus_left/illu_03.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u3{background:url(../../../../../fileadmin/illus_left/illu_04.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u4{background:url(../../../../../fileadmin/illus_left/illu_05.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u5{background:url(../../../../../fileadmin/illus_left/illu_06.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u6{background:url(../../../../../fileadmin/illus_left/illu_07.jpg);background-repeat:no-repeat;background-position:0px 0px;}
.ksIllu7{background:url(../../../../../fileadmin/illus_left/illu_08.jpg);background-repeat:no-repeat;background-position:0px 0px;}

.mpAdressText, .ksLeftIllu .mpAdressText{padding:280px 0 0 20px;line-height:18px;}

.hpWelcome1{font-size:28px;font-family:times,garamond,serif;font-weight:bold;color:#424142;padding:0 0 4px 0;letter-spacing:0.3px;_letter-spacing:1.2px;}
.hpWelcome2{font-size:22px;font-family:times,garamond,serif;font-weight:normal;color:#424142;
letter-spacing:0.3px;_letter-spacing:1.2px;}

.ksColTitle{width:423px;height:18px;color:#fff;font-size:12px;letter-spacing:0.8px;_letter-spacing:1.5px;font-weight:bold;padding:6px 0 0 34px;_padding-bottom:2px;margin-bottom:18px;}
.ksColRed{background-color:#CE0008;}
.ksColGreen{background-color:#ADC39C;}
.ksColBlue{background-color:#004D84;}
.ksColGrey{background-color:#ADBABD;}
.ksColViolet{background-color:#844D9C;}
.ksColYellow{background-color:#E7E0BA;color:#000 !important;}
.ksColOrange{background-color:#EF8218;}
.ksColBrown{background-color:#7C695A;}

.ksTitleTeaseTable{width:505px;}
.ksTitleTeaseTable th{color:#fff;font-size:12px;height:40px;text-align:right;}
.ksTitleTeaseTable td{color:#424142;font-size:11px;padding:10px 9px 18px 9px;}
.ksMPtabTitle,th .ksMPtabTitle,.ksTitleTeaseTable .ksMPtabTitle th{padding:21px 11px 4px 0;}
td.ksMPTDwid, .ksTitleTeaseTable td.ksMPTDwid{width:125px;}

table.ksSubPoints {margin:12px 0 0 0;}
.ksSubPoints td{padding:0 0 0 6px;}
.ksSubPoints td .ksSub,.ksSub{font-size:12px;line-height:22px;}
table.ksSubSub {margin:0 0 6px 0;}
.ksSubPoints td .ksSubSub,.ksSubSub{font-size:11px;line-height:20px;}

table.ksPartners{width:435px;margin:24px 0 0 0;letter-spacing:0.3px;_letter-spacing:0.6px;}
table.ksPartners tr{height:60px;font-size:12px;}
.ksPartners td hr{background-color:#424142;height:1px;border:0 none;clear:both;display:block;width:380px;margin:6px 20px 0 0;}

.tx-thmailformplus-pi1, .tx-thmailformplus-pi1 table,.tx-thmailformplus-pi1 table tr td{font-size:11px;line-height:28px;}
.tx-thmailformplus-pi1 table tr td{vertical-align:top;}
.tx-thmailformplus-pi1 table{margin:24px 0 0 0;}
.tx-thmailformplus-pi1 table tr td input{width:240px;}
.tx-thmailformplus-pi1 table tr td input .radioBox,.radioBox{width:20px !important;}
.tx-thmailformplus-pi1 table tr td input .submitBut,.submitBut{width:120px !important;}

.csc-uploads,.csc-uploads-0,.csc-uploads td,.csc-uploads-0 td.csc-uploads-fileName{font-size:11px;}

/* Erg�nzungen FK */
div#subnavi { margin-bottom:30px; }

div.mitarbeiter { clear: both; }
div.mitarbeiter h2 { color: rgb(206, 0, 8); font-weight:bold; font-size:12px }
div.mitarbeiter h3 { font-weight:bold; font-style:italic; font-size:14px; color:#434343; }
div.mitarbeiter img { float:left; margin:0 20px 20px 0; border:1px solid #BBBBBB; }
div.mitarbeiter a.download { background:url(/img/arrow_red.gif) no-repeat 0px 3px; padding-left:10px; }

table.contenttable { border-collapse:collapse; }
table.contenttable th { border:solid 1px #dddddd; border-spacing:10px; padding:5px; font-size:12px; background-color:#f6f6f6; }
table.contenttable td { border:solid 1px #dddddd; border-spacing:10px; padding:5px; font-size:12px; }

a.nav14,a.nav14:link,a.nav14:visited,a.nav14:active { color:#004D85 !important; }
a.nav14:hover { text-decoration:underline; color:#004D85 !important; }
a.nav13,a.nav13:link,a.nav13:visited,a.nav13:active { color:#8E9C9C !important; }
a.nav13:hover { text-decoration:underline; color:#8E9C9C !important; }
a.nav19,a.nav19:link,a.nav19:visited,a.nav19:active { color:#7C695A !important; }
a.nav19:hover { text-decoration:underline; color:#7C695A !important; }
a.nav15,a.nav15:link,a.nav15:visited,a.nav15:active { color:#758467 !important; }
a.nav15:hover { text-decoration:underline; color:#758467 !important; }
a.nav57,a.nav57:link,a.nav57:visited,a.nav57:active { color:#EF8218 !important; }
a.nav57:hover { text-decoration:underline; color:#EF8218 !important; }

div.naviOn {background:url(../../../../../fileadmin/templates/main/img/arrow-left.gif); background-repeat:no-repeat; background-position:right 4px; }
div.naviOn a { margin-right:10px; }


ul#smapEntry{text-align:left; list-style:none;padding:0; margin:0;width:70%;}
ul#smapEntry li{ display:block; margin:0;padding:0; }
ul#smapEntry.level1 li{padding:24px 0 0 0px; }
ul#smapEntry.level2 li{padding:6px 0 0 11px; _margin:-1px 0 -9px 0;}
ul#smapEntry.level3 li{padding:6px 0 0 11px; _margin:-8px 0 -5px 0;}
ul#smapEntry.level4 li{padding:0 0 0 33px;}
ul#smapEntry.level5 li{padding:0 0 0 44px;}

ul#smapEntry li a{
display:block; width:100%; padding:0.5em 0 0.5em 2em;
border-width:0px;color:#424142;text-decoration:none;background:#F4F4F4;
}
#navcontainer>ul#smapEntry li a{width:auto;}
ul#smapEntry li#active a{background:#f0e7d7;color:#800000;}
ul#smapEntry li a:hover, ul#smapEntry li#active a:hover{
color:#424142; text-decoration:underline !important; background:#ECECEC; font-weight:bold;
}
div#jub-border-pos { position:relative; }
div#jubilaeum { position:absolute; top:-55px; left:222px; }


.mainContentCell div.partner { float:left; width:229px; height:140px; font-size:12px; }
.mainContentCell div.partner img { margin-top:6px; }

.xinglink { float:right; width:140px; }

.rechtlicherHinweis { width:883px; margin-left:160px; padding:20px; font-size:11px; color:#999; }

